Chain Lubrication Test
Hold the chain just above a dry surface and open the throttle to
half speed for 30 seconds.
A thin line of “thrown” oil should be seen on the dry surface.
Cutting Instructions
General
This chain saw is designed for cutting wood or wood
products. Do not cut solid metal, sheet metal, plastic or
any non-wood materials.
Read the ECHO “CHAIN SAW SAFETY MANUAL”
included with your chain saw for additional cutting and
safety instructions.
Wear suitable hearing protection such as earmuffs or
earplugs to protect against objectionable or
uncomfortable loud noises.
Do not let the tip of the bar touch anything while the
engine is running. At cutting speed the chain is moving
at a high rate of speed. Should the tip contact a limb or
log while the chain is moving, the tip will be pushed
upward with considerable force. This is known as
kickback. Avoid it!
In all circumstances the operation of the chain saw is a
one-man job. It is difficult at times to take care for your own
safety, so don’t assume the responsibility for a helper as well.
After you have learned the basic techniques of using the saw,
your best aid will be your own good common sense.
The accepted way to hold the saw is to stand to the left of the
saw with your left hand on the front handlebar and your right
hand on the rear handle so you can operate the throttle trigger
with your right index finger. Before attempting to fell a tree, cut
some small logs or limbs. Become thoroughly familiar with the
controls and the responses of the saw.
